Artemis Foundas and Doug Lang first met when they were attending Blue Valley North High School in the same graduating class. Ten years later, they crossed paths again and that is when their relationship started.  Doug’s a video game enthusiast who’s always searching for old video arcade games. Early in their relationship, Artemis accompanied him when he purchased a Ms. Pac-Man cocktail table.

“This was the first arcade game we purchased together,” Doug relates. “Artemis had fond memories playing a Ms. Pac-Man in Greece, where she grew up. As my basement arcade collection grew, the Ms. Pac-Man was the one we played a lot together.

“When I knew I wanted to propose to Artemis, I thought about reprograming a Ms. Pac-Man to say the words ‘Will you marry me?’ I also wanted to change the bonus points icons in the game to things like our cats, an engagement ring, etc.” Since he couldn’t use the existing game, Doug found another stand-up game and stashed it at his parents’ house while he reprogrammed it. Artemis enjoys watching vloggers on YouTube, so Doug also put together months of video clips in a vlog style that showed his progress. He contacted Alamo Drafthouse and arranged to position the game in the lobby and for his video to be played in a theater.

“We walked into the Alamo Drafthouse lobby; she saw the Ms. Pac-man arcade in the middle of the lobby but didn’t question it, as she kept looking to see what the surprise movie was. I asked if she’d like to play the Ms. Pac-Man, and as we walked closer she saw the main screen display ‘Artemis, will you marry me?’ I got down on one knee to ask her and she said ‘Yes!’”

“As she was playing the game, she enjoyed seeing all the changes I had put in it. When she finished playing, I told her, ‘Let’s go, we’re late for the movie!’ We opened the door to the theater and our family and friends were waiting inside to congratulate us. After a few minutes the lights dimmed and that’s when the vlog I had made started playing on the big screen.”

Artemis and Doug are planning a December 2017 wedding, where the Ms. Pac-Man will be there for guests to play! ■
